AEMPSDecision Date: October 3, 2022 The Supreme Court of Spain ordered the partial unblocking of the website of the Women on Web International Foundation (“WOW”), which published information on sexual and reproductive rights and offered mifepristone and misoprostol, drugs commonly used to end a pregnancy, in exchange for a monetary donation.   In Stewart, the Supreme Court confirmed that the assignment of renewal rights by an author before the time for renewal arrives cannot defeat the right of the author’s statutory successors to the renewal rights if the author dies before the right to renewal accrues. [read post]
